‘Oppenheimer’ IMAX Film Prints Are 11 Miles Long and Weigh 600 Pounds

Is the weight worth the wait?

Christopher Nolan’s Oppenheimer is gearing up to drop in theaters in less than two months. There is a lot to be excited about when we think about Nolan’s latest R-rated film, his first since Insomnia. From the double release with Greta Gerwig’s Barbie to using practical effects for explosions to using special-made cameras to capture the explosions in slow motion, we can’t wait to see what this three-hour, IMAX masterpiece has in store for us.

Nolan confirmed last month to Total Film magazine that Oppenheimer is the longest movie of his career, running shy of the three-hour mark. However, the IMAX film prints tell a different story.
